1006 tristate "Maxim MAX6621 sensor chip"
1007 depends on I2C
1010 If you say yes here you get support for MAX6621 sensor chip.
1011 MAX6621 is a PECI-to-I2C translator provides an efficient,
1012 low-cost solution for PECI-to-SMBus/I2C protocol conversion.
1013 It allows reading the temperature from the PECI-compliant
1014 host directly from up to four PECI-enabled CPUs.
